    Launch the Console application in any of the following ways:
    ☞ Enter the first few letters of its name into a Spotlight search. Select it in the results (it should be at the top.)
    ☞ In the Finder, select Go ▹ Utilities from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-U. The application is in the folder that opens.
    ☞ If you’re running OS X 10.7 or later, open LaunchPad. Click Utilities, then Console in the page that opens.
    Step 1
    Enter the name of the crashed application or process in the Filter text field. Post the messages from the time of the last crash, if any — the text, please, not a screenshot.
    Important: Some private information, such as your name, may appear in the log. Edit it out by search-and-replace in a text editor before posting.
    Step 2
    Still in the Console window, look under User Diagnostic Reports for crash reports related to the process. The report name starts with the name of the crashed process, and ends with ".crash". Select the most recent report and post the contents — again, the text, not a screenshot. In the interest of privacy, I suggest that, before posting, you edit out the “Anonymous UUID,” a long string of letters, numbers, and dashes in the header of the report, if it’s present (it may not be.) Please don’t post shutdownStall or hang logs — they're very long and not helpful.

  • Does the new MBP run hot?

    I'm looking to buy the new MBP 15". Does anyone know if it runs hot? My current white polycarbonate first generation Intel Macbook always runs ridiculously hot.
    Thanks!

    Picked up a new 15" very recently. Subjective heat evaluation:
    9400M: Very cool during general use (web browsing/email/etc...) Warm during gaming (WoW).
    9600M GT: Warm during general use. Hot during gaming. VERY hot in Windows, gaming or not.
    Of note, Windows only sees the 9600M GT, and gets uncomfortably hot (to the point I'm not only uncomfortable using it on my lap, but feel like I ought to be pointing a fan at the bottom-left (where the GPU is located).
    The laptop was never uncomfortable on the 9400M, even while running WoW with the laptop directly on my lap. Just pleasantly warm. Same circumstances with the 9600M GT enabled I needed to throw a lapdesk under it, but it didn't get nearly as hot as under Windows.
